Global print and packaging supplier Multi Packaging Solutions (MPS) has made two new acquisitions. In the UK, it has acquired AJS Labels, which is based in Littlehampton and Featherstone.

Established over 40 years ago, AJS supplies many major brands, including Nestlé, Sainsbury’s and The Body Shop, with self-adhesive, digital and flexo printed labels. It employs around 80 people over its two manufacturing sites. AJS recently won two categories at the FlexoTech Awards for the L’Oréal Magic Retouch Beige label. This went on to win Label of Year at the UK Packaging Awards.

In the US, MPS has acquired i3 Plastic Cards, based in Dallas, Texas. i3 produces plastic transaction cards, including pre-paid gift and loyalty cards.

Collectively the businesses recorded net sales of approximately $25 million in the last 12 months.
